Before any material technique can prosper, an agency needs to guarantee a client's website is technically sound. These tools go deeper than general suites to find crawl mistakes, broken links, and schema problems.
3. Yelling Frog SEO Spider
A staple in the industry, this desktop-based crawler is essential for auditing big business websites. It enables agency teams to export massive quantities of data into spreadsheets for granular analysis.
4. Sitebulb
Sitebulb takes the information from a crawl and turns it into actionable insights with visual representations. It is especially beneficial for agencies that need to discuss technical jargon to clients who might not be tech-savvy.

Not every agency provides the same services. Depending upon the specific niche, additional tools may be needed.
Regional SEO: BrightLocal
For agencies handling regional services or franchises, BrightLocal is the gold requirement. It tracks map pack rankings, manages citations, and automates the procedure of generating customer reviews.
Content Strategy: Surfer SEO or Clearscope
When an agency's main deliverable is premium content, use tools that take advantage of NLP (Natural Language Processing). These tools analyze the top-ranking outcomes for a keyword and offer a blueprint for what a brand-new piece of material requires to consist of to rank.

For companies just beginning out, a mix of Google Search Console (Free), Screaming Frog (Free version up to 500 URLs), and a base subscription to SEMrush or Mangools is typically the most cost-effective way to get extensive data.
Why is white-labeling important for SEO companies?
White-labeling allows an agency to present third-party information as their own branded work item. This constructs brand authority and provides an expert experience for the customer, reinforcing the agency's worth as a specialized company.
Can an agency rely solely on complimentary SEO tools?
While possible, it is not suggested for scaling. Free tools typically have data limits, lack historical information, and do not use automatic reporting. The time spent by hand compiling information from free tools usually costs more in billable hours than the price of a paid subscription.
How numerous SEO tools does a typical agency require?
The majority of effective companies make use of a "Power Trio": one all-in-one suite (like Ahrefs or SEMrush), one technical crawler (like Screaming Frog), and one committed reporting control panel (like AgencyAnalytics or Looker Studio).
Do these tools supply 100% precise keyword volume?
No. Keyword volume is a quote based on clickstream data and historic trends. Agencies must utilize these numbers as relative indicators of popularity instead of outright figures, always cross-referencing with data from Google Ads Keyword Planner.
